[QUOTE="easyk83, post: 698462, member: 8895"] Whos to say some of these fans wouldn't have also turned on Wolf if he had a title drought of similar length? Wolf left after his Super Bowl core had either aged retired or left. Sean Jones, Reggie White, Eugene Robinson among others were all gone. Ted Thompson on the other hand stuck around for a reload on Offense and Defense. Ted Thompson never did build a team as dominant as those mid 90s Packer squads and Wolf might have also won a title in 95 if not for the league's scheduling. Then again how do you factor in coaching? IMHO Holmgren never would have tolerated long term ineffectiveness amongst his coaching staff the way that MM has. I suspect we would have had a new DC by the 13 or 14 season. Special note: while Wolf did use FA, and this has been noted repeatedly on here, Wolf used FA at a time when most GMs were skeptical and the market was more favorable for the team acquiring players. I do rate Ted Thompson as the better drafter though. [/QUOTE]
